Sri Lankan youth volunteers set world record
25 August 2011
!500 Sri Lankan youth broke the Guinness World Record for the Largest Human Mosaic when they formed the word "youth" at Colombo University on International Youth Day 12 August 2011. (Lakshman Nadaraja, 2011)
This year, “youth” was more than just a word to volunteers involved with Sri Lankan youth service organizations.  On 12 August, International Youth Day, 1500 youth volunteers assembled on a Colombo sports field to form the word “youth” and break the Guinness World Record for the Largest Human Mosaic. The voice of youth: International Day of Youth
11 August 2011
In Thateng town, Sekong Province, 800 km south of the capital of Lao PDR, 19-year-old Nouan Anong fits her headphones for the morning news. Nouan is a volunteer radio anchor with the Thatheng Ethnic Community Radio for Development station. “This is a unique opportunity to volunteer and represent my Ta-oi ethnic group,” says Nouan. “I can communicate in my own language so the community understands what is happening around them.” Through volunteering, Nouan has become the voice of her peers. (Philippe Pernet / UNV)
Bonn, Germany: This year marks both the International Year of Youth and the tenth anniversary of the International Year of Volunteers (IYV+10). It’s a unique opportunity to recognize how young people can take a stand and help change the world for the better. Read

Releasing potential to boost sales
03 August 2011
Peter Whitney (left), UN corporate/private sector Volunteer from Kraft Argentina, at a women cooperative in Aita Al Foukhar village, tasting their specialty 'Labneh' (local product) made with goat cheese. (UNV, 2011)
Bekaa Valley, Lebanon: Women food cooperatives in the region of Bekaa produce high quality natural foods. Despite good manufacturing facilities and excellent products, marketing and sales continue to be a challenge. Two UN corporate/private sector Volunteers from Kraft Foods helped the cooperatives find ways to boost sales. Read
